Title: Cannot extend lint process anymore · Issue #4344 · angular/angular-cli · GitHub
Open Graph Title: Cannot extend lint process anymore · Issue #4344 · angular/angular-cli
X Title: Cannot extend lint process anymore · Issue #4344 · angular/angular-cli
Description: With the release of the beta28 version and due to this PR, we cannot extend the ng lint command which is a serious regression for my projects. With the previous beta26, by changing the npm scripts section we could extend the lint process...
Open Graph Description: With the release of the beta28 version and due to this PR, we cannot extend the ng lint command which is a serious regression for my projects. With the previous beta26, by changing the npm scripts ...
X Description: With the release of the beta28 version and due to this PR, we cannot extend the ng lint command which is a serious regression for my projects. With the previous beta26, by changing the npm scripts ...
Opengraph URL: https://github.com/angular/angular-cli/issues/4344
X: @github
Domain: github.com
{"@context":"https://schema.org","@type":"DiscussionForumPosting","headline":"Cannot extend lint process anymore","articleBody":"With the release of the `beta28` version and due to [this PR](https://github.com/angular/angular-cli/pull/4248/files), we cannot extend the `ng lint` command which is a serious regression for my projects.\r\n\r\nWith the previous `beta26`, by changing the `npm scripts` section we could extend the lint process like this:\r\n```\r\n \"scripts\": {\r\n \"lint\": \"tslint \\\"src/**/*.ts\\\" \\\"e2e/**/*.ts\\\" \u0026\u0026 stylelint \\\"src/**/*.scss\\\" --syntax scss \u0026\u0026 htmlhint \\\"src\\\"\"\r\n```\r\n\r\nNow that this was removed, we cannot extend the behavior of `ng lint` anymore with the addition of `stylelint` and `htmllint`...\r\n\r\nThis is quite a regression, while I understand the move to the tslint API for better integration, it also complicates the process by hiding it behind JSON settings and kills any customization like the one I was doing. For the meanwhile I'll move my process to use `npm scripts` directly, but it would be nice to find some middle ground on this.\r\n\r\nThis sort of breaking changes kinda make me worry about the future of `angular-cli`, removing customization features like this are bad in a maintenance update (yeah I understand it's still beta, still).\r\n","author":{"url":"https://github.com/sinedied","@type":"Person","name":"sinedied"},"datePublished":"2017-02-02T08:26:12.000Z","interactionStatistic":{"@type":"InteractionCounter","interactionType":"https://schema.org/CommentAction","userInteractionCount":6},"url":"https://github.com/4344/angular-cli/issues/4344"}
| route-pattern | /_view_fragments/issues/show/:user_id/:repository/:id/issue_layout(.:format) |
| route-controller | voltron_issues_fragments |
| route-action | issue_layout |
| fetch-nonce | v2:dfebdb0e-39dc-14de-d5c3-707d09295ea2 |
| current-catalog-service-hash | 81bb79d38c15960b92d99bca9288a9108c7a47b18f2423d0f6438c5b7bcd2114 |
| request-id | C9AA:14207:BE0D77B:F54ECAB:6976A0EF |
| html-safe-nonce | 69ee6b14d331104421d435f79a983599624b40eda81c28b61fab75e90ca598b2 |
| visitor-payload | eyJyZWZlcnJlciI6IiIsInJlcXVlc3RfaWQiOiJDOUFBOjE0MjA3OkJFMEQ3N0I6RjU0RUNBQjo2OTc2QTBFRiIsInZpc2l0b3JfaWQiOiI4ODYwMzY3OTIyNTI2NTkzMjYzIiwicmVnaW9uX2VkZ2UiOiJpYWQiLCJyZWdpb25fcmVuZGVyIjoiaWFkIn0= |
| visitor-hmac | 1f5c98adc41f60bd8e3bae8643349f3b209879eb071e809b6460a8a5766f7820 |
| hovercard-subject-tag | issue:204809555 |
| github-keyboard-shortcuts | repository,issues,copilot |
| google-site-verification | Apib7-x98H0j5cPqHWwSMm6dNU4GmODRoqxLiDzdx9I |
| octolytics-url | https://collector.github.com/github/collect |
| analytics-location | / |
| fb:app_id | 1401488693436528 |
| apple-itunes-app | app-id=1477376905, app-argument=https://github.com/_view_fragments/issues/show/angular/angular-cli/4344/issue_layout |
| twitter:image | https://opengraph.githubassets.com/494766d7f976450019b98d80fc80af01174f645d527d2731e6070680c408d5f5/angular/angular-cli/issues/4344 |
| twitter:card | summary_large_image |
| og:image | https://opengraph.githubassets.com/494766d7f976450019b98d80fc80af01174f645d527d2731e6070680c408d5f5/angular/angular-cli/issues/4344 |
| og:image:alt | With the release of the beta28 version and due to this PR, we cannot extend the ng lint command which is a serious regression for my projects. With the previous beta26, by changing the npm scripts ... |
| og:image:width | 1200 |
| og:image:height | 600 |
| og:site_name | GitHub |
| og:type | object |
| og:author:username | sinedied |
| hostname | github.com |
| expected-hostname | github.com |
| None | 032152924a283b83384255d9489e7b93b54ba01da8d380b05ecd3953b3212411 |
| turbo-cache-control | no-preview |
| go-import | github.com/angular/angular-cli git https://github.com/angular/angular-cli.git |
| octolytics-dimension-user_id | 139426 |
| octolytics-dimension-user_login | angular |
| octolytics-dimension-repository_id | 36891867 |
| octolytics-dimension-repository_nwo | angular/angular-cli |
| octolytics-dimension-repository_public | true |
| octolytics-dimension-repository_is_fork | false |
| octolytics-dimension-repository_network_root_id | 36891867 |
| octolytics-dimension-repository_network_root_nwo | angular/angular-cli |
| turbo-body-classes | logged-out env-production page-responsive |
| disable-turbo | false |
| browser-stats-url | https://api.github.com/_private/browser/stats |
| browser-errors-url | https://api.github.com/_private/browser/errors |
| release | 5b577f6be6482e336e3c30e8daefa30144947b17 |
| ui-target | canary-1 |
| theme-color | #1e2327 |
| color-scheme | light dark |
Links:
Viewport: width=device-width